The Physiological Link Between Iron and Muscle Function

Iron is more than a mineral; it’s the key to our muscle movements. It’s essential for our bodies to function well. Without enough iron, we might feel muscle cramps and wonder: can iron deficiency cause muscle cramps?

Oxygen Transport and Cellular Energy

Oxygen is vital for our physical health. Iron helps carry oxygen in our blood. Without enough iron, our muscles don’t get the oxygen they need.

Iron also helps with myoglobin, a protein in muscles. It stores oxygen for quick energy. Low iron means less energy for muscles, leading to fatigue and weakness.

The Reality of Normal Hemoglobin with Low Ferritin

It might surprise you to know that your body can struggle with low iron even if your blood count looks fine. Many people visit doctors with muscle cramps, only to find their blood tests are normal. This is because tests mainly look at hemoglobin, which shows iron depletion late.

Can You Be Anemic with a Normal Hemoglobin?

Yes, you can feel the effects of iron deficiency without being technically anemic. Anemia is diagnosed when hemoglobin levels fall below a certain point. But, your body can have normal iron levels but low ferritin, meaning it’s out of iron before your blood count shows it.

Having normal hb with low ferritin often affects your muscles first. Your body focuses on delivering oxygen to important organs, leaving your muscles weak. This can cause muscle spasms and weakness during daily tasks.

Why Ferritin Levels Matter More Than You Think

Many patients are surprised to find their blood work looks normal even when they’re low on iron. Standard tests focus on iron in the blood but miss the hidden reserves in muscles. This can leave you feeling muscle pain without clear answers.

Ferritin as the Primary Storage Marker

Ferritin is like your body’s emergency savings account for iron. It’s not just about the iron in your blood; ferritin is the stored iron for when you need it most. Low ferritin levels mean your body is using up its stored iron to keep basic functions going.

So, why might ferritin be low but iron levels seem normal? It’s because your body prioritizes keeping blood iron levels stable. It uses stored iron to keep your blood chemistry looking good on basic tests. This is why low ferritin can be tricky to spot during routine check-ups.

The Progression of Iron Store Depletion

Iron loss happens in stages. First, your body uses stored iron, lowering ferritin while keeping hemoglobin stable. Then, without enough iron, your body can’t make enough red blood cells, dropping hemoglobin.

How Low Iron Triggers Lactic Acid Accumulation

When your body lacks enough iron, your muscles change in a way that causes discomfort. People often ask, “can iron deficiency cause muscle cramps?” They are seeing the effects of this imbalance. Without enough iron, your muscles can’t make energy the way they should.

The Metabolic Consequences of Oxygen Starvation

Normally, your muscles use oxygen to make energy well. But when iron levels are low, oxygen can’t get to them as well. This makes your muscles use a less efficient way to make energy.

This change leads to lactic acid being made as energy is produced. Unfortunately, this acid doesn’t clear out as fast when there’s not enough oxygen. It builds up in muscles, causing problems with how they work.

Transferrin Saturation as an Independent Risk Factor

Beyond ferritin, transferrin saturation (TSAT) serves as a critical marker for assessing how well iron is being transported to tissues. Research indicates that low TSAT levels act as an independent risk factor for muscle pain and fatigue. Even when other health markers appear stable, a drop in saturation can trigger significant muscle issues.
